I have a friend who has a shop that works on European cars, Jaguars,
BMW, Mercedes, Audi and VW's. His big cravat is that ONCE A LUXURY CAR,
ALWAYS A LUXURY CAR! ! ! If it cost big bucks when it was new parts and
labor will be big bucks when it is 15 + years old and the wear gremlins
sneak in. You have been working with 80's vintage VW Rabbits, Dashers and
Quantams. Parts are cheap and the cars are relitivly simple. Graduate to the
90's European luxury cars and you will probably need to find a good
mechanic and a much fatter wallet to keep the machines on the road.

I may have a chance to trade one of my collector cars for a 1996 Mercedes
E300 diesel with 168,000 miles on it, reputedly in good shape. Is this a
good or bad year for that model? Anything in particular I should watch out
for that could spell expensive repairs in the near future? One member in the
past suggested that the years 1985 & 1987 were the best years for Mercedes
diesels.
